About Wild West Lighting
Wild West Lighting is a Manufacturers Representative of Lighting, Lighting Controls, and Energy Management Systems in the State of Arizona. Wild West markets a diverse group of Lighting manufacturers to the construction, design and end-user communities.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Scottsdale?

Understanding the cost of living near Scottsdale is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Wild West Lighting.
Scottsdale's Cost of Living Index is approximately 125.4 (25.4% more expensive than US average; 21.5% more than AZ average). Very affluent area, driven by extremely high housing costs, upscale amenities, and higher prices for goods/services.
